Tell us a more about your role and what a typical day in the life is like.

I work on the AIA account based out of Singapore and we help them manage the AIA/Spurs Partnership across 18 markets in Asia! A typical day would start off with client catch ups where we talk about the weekend Premier League/football results (which takes up most of our time) before getting down to working out our priorities for the day and week. As exciting as it sounds, our day will usually revolve meeting people virtually across the world where we share updates on the partnership and help AIA markets utilise the partnership better to help them achieve their business objectives.
